Entering the Room
• Please enter quietly. • Have a seat.• Take out your materials.• Begin DO NOW assignment.
Classroom Discussions
• PLEASE raise your hand to participate.• I want to hear what you have to say.• Make all questions and comments relevant to
the current discussion.• If a visitor is in the room or at the door, please continue to work without speaking.
Moving Around the Room• You must ask permission.• Do not ask to get up or move
during a classroom discussion unless it is an emergency.
• When completing a lab, stay with your group at your assigned area.
Turning in Work/Missing Work
• Turn in work in the designated area.• Make sure that your name is on ALL
assignments you turn in. If you miss class, see the “While You Were Out Folder” on the wall.
• Please remember the 63% rule for absences and tardies.
• Five (5) unexcused absences results in automatic grade of (F) for the course.
Class Dismissal•The teacher dismisses you, not the bell.•Do not start packing up prior to the bell.•Wait until the teacher finishes and officially dismisses you.
